WebMost can accommodate a new-born and have a rear-facing weight limit of 40-50 lbs. Forward-facing weight limits are usually 65 lbs. Because of the higher rear-facing weight limits they allow your child to travel rear-facing for longer, which means they stay safer longer. Note that convertible seats cannot be used as a booster seat.
